Frequently Asked Questions
What specific local zoning or land use issues should I discuss with a Yorktown, IN real estate attorney?
A Yorktown attorney can advise on local zoning ordinances in Delaware County, which may affect property use, accessory structures, or home-based businesses. They are also familiar with regulations from the Yorktown Plan Commission and can help with variance requests or navigating the town's comprehensive plan for development.
How can a Yorktown real estate attorney help with a transaction involving property in the Mounds Lake or White River watershed areas?
Properties near these water bodies may be subject to specific environmental regulations, floodplain restrictions, or conservation easements. A local attorney can review surveys, title work, and county records to identify any use limitations or disclosure requirements unique to these sensitive areas in Delaware County.
What are common fee structures for a real estate attorney handling a residential closing in Yorktown, Indiana?
Most attorneys in Yorktown charge a flat fee for standard residential transactions, typically ranging from $500 to $1,200, depending on complexity. This usually covers title review, document preparation, and closing coordination. Always request a detailed engagement letter outlining all costs upfront.
When is it necessary to hire a local Yorktown attorney instead of one from Muncie or Indianapolis for a real estate matter?
Hiring a Yorktown-based attorney is particularly beneficial for matters involving local town ordinances, variances before the Yorktown Plan Commission, or disputes with neighbors over property lines governed by Delaware County records. Their established relationships with local title companies and officials can streamline the process.
Can a real estate attorney in Yorktown assist with issues related to the historic districts or older properties in town?
Yes. An attorney familiar with Yorktown can advise on potential restrictions for properties in or near recognized areas, help review historic preservation covenants, and ensure proper disclosures for older homes regarding lead-based paint or outdated systems, in compliance with both Indiana state law and local guidelines.
